Output 76ba755bc1a3d94f964383ad1ad2d201d8d9c991882710464a80a10e812ee80f:5

value
708605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5cfe4a6c96ead8a8bbd5540dcd46aa27ba5c989 OP_EQUAL
address
3Q6kXDJQe7hr8EBPC4yE7q2pRo1n1W5wX5
transaction
76ba755bc1a3d94f964383ad1ad2d201d8d9c991882710464a80a10e812ee80f
spent
true